The excerpt contains the 3rd of 4 bullet points in a set of recommended additions/changes to the socialist Left's electoral-strategy toolkit:
--
Preserve the power of volunteer-driven conversations while adapting how we reach voters. Volunteer-driven conversations should remain at the heart of our field model, but statewide campaigns will need to rely less exclusively on traditional canvassing and more on relational organizing-building networks of local volunteers who can organize their friends, coworkers, neighbors, and communities.
